Q: Is 221,952 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 221,952 is a composite number.

Why is 221,952 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 221,952 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 17 24 32 34 48 51 64 68 96 102 128 136 192 204 256 272 289 384 408 544 578 768 816 867 1,088 1,156 1,632 1,734 2,176 2,312 3,264 3,468 4,352 4,624 6,528 6,936 9,248 13,056 13,872 18,496 27,744 36,992 55,488 73,984 110,976 and 221,952, with no remainder.

Since 221,952 cannot be divided by just 1 and 221,952, it is a composite number.
